What Is a Dental Assisting Program Online?
A Dental Assisting program Online is a structured educational course designed to train students in the skills needed to support dentists in patient care, administrative tasks, and laboratory procedures. These programs combine online coursework with practical hands-on training, often via local partnerships or practicums.
Online dental assisting programs typically cover topics such as:
- Anatomy and physiology of the mouth
- Dental radiography
- Infection control and sterilization
- Dental office management
- Patient care and communication
- Dental materials and laboratory procedures
most programs prepare students for certification exams, such as the Certified Dental Assistant (CDA) exam, which is highly recommended for employment in many dental offices.
Key Features of online Dental Assisting Programs
Flexibility and Convenience
One of the biggest advantages of online dental assisting programs is their flexibility.Students can access lectures, assignments, and resources anytime and anywhere, making it easier to balance education with personal and professional responsibilities.
Comprehensive Curriculum
Online programs deliver in-depth coursework through engaging multimedia content,including videos,interactive quizzes,and virtual labs. Some programs also offer live webinars and discussion forums for real-time interaction with instructors and classmates.
Practical Hands-On Training
Despite being online, these programs recognize the importance of hands-on experience.Students are usually required to complete externships, internships, or practicums at local dental offices, ensuring they gain real-world skills.

how to Choose the Right Online Dental Assisting Program
Accreditation and Certification
Ensure the program is accredited by reputable agencies such as the Dental Assisting National Board (DANB) or regional authorities. Accreditation guarantees the curriculum meets industry standards and prepares you for certification exams.
Program Reputation and Reviews
Research student reviews and success stories.Look for programs with high graduation and employment rates.
support and Resources
Pick programs offering comprehensive student support, including accessible instructors, career services, and externship placement assistance.
